CESTAT rules in favor of ZEEL, ₹4.62 crore tax demand vacated

The RealCase readMedium impact Positive

CESTAT rules in favor of ZEEL, dismissing an appeal and vacating a ₹4.62 crore tax demand related to service tax on subscription income from J&K.

* CESTAT ruled in favor of Zee Entertainment Enterprises Limited (ZEEL), dismissing an appeal by the Commissioner of Service Tax - I, Mumbai. * The order, uploaded on October 15, 2025, pertains to a service tax matter regarding subscription income from Jammu & Kashmir (J&K) treated as exempted income. * The dispute concerned the input tax credit utilization exceeding 20%, which the company contested by stating that it maintained separate records for J&K and made proportionate credit reversal. * Consequently, a tax demand of ₹4.62 crore for the financial years 2004-05, 2006-07 & 2007-08, which was disclosed earlier as a contingent liability, now stands vacated/nullified.
